SN - 9780300121605 AV - NB450 .C65 2008 CY - Washington : PB - National Gallery of Art KW - Sculpture KW - Congresses KW - European KW - Collectors and collecting KW - Europe N1 - Based on an international conference held on the occasion of the opening of the new sculpture galleries in the NGA, Washington, DC in 2003 N2 - "In this book twenty scholars examine the history of the collecting of sculpture from the late Middle Ages to the nineteenth century, as represented in the collections of royal families, aristocratic amateurs, and artists. The essays explore the nature of collecting, whether as a form of opulent interior decoration, as a means of outdoor display in architecture and landscape architecture, or as an accumulation of studio models. Case studies are drawn from Italian, French, German, Dutch, Flemish, and English examples."--Jacket ER -
